Abstract
The invention discloses a traditional Chinese medicine formula for dispelling wind cold, ventilating the lung and relieving cough and a preparation method thereof, wherein the traditional Chinese medicine composition comprises the following components in parts by weight: 50-150 parts of prepared rhizome of rehmannia, 15-45 parts of liquorice, 50-150 parts of Chinese yam, 50-150 parts of ginkgo seed, 50-150 parts of rhizoma alismatis, 25-75 parts of ephedra, 25-75 parts of cortex moutan, 50-150 parts of aconite, 25-75 parts of poria cocos and 50-150 parts of cornus pulp. The invention adopts prepared rhizome of rehmannia, liquorice, chinese yam, ginkgo, rhizoma alismatis, ephedra herb, cortex moutan, radix aconiti lateralis preparata, tuckahoe and dogwood fruit to treat cough of patients by dispelling wind and cold and ventilating lung qi, has quick response and relieves the pain of the patients.

In order to achieve the purpose, the invention provides the following technical scheme: a traditional Chinese medicine formula for dispelling wind cold, ventilating the lung and relieving cough and a preparation method thereof are disclosed, wherein the traditional Chinese medicine composition comprises the following components in parts by weight:
50-150 parts of prepared rhizome of rehmannia, 15-45 parts of liquorice, 50-150 parts of Chinese yam, 50-150 parts of ginkgo seed, 50-150 parts of rhizoma alismatis, 25-75 parts of ephedra, 25-75 parts of cortex moutan, 50-150 parts of aconite, 25-75 parts of poria cocos and 50-150 parts of cornus pulp.
Preferably, the traditional Chinese medicine composition comprises the following components in parts by weight:
100 parts of prepared rhizome of rehmannia, 30 parts of liquorice, 100 parts of Chinese yam, 100 parts of ginkgo, 100 parts of alisma orientale, 50 parts of ephedra, 50 parts of cortex moutan, 100 parts of aconite, 50 parts of tuckahoe and 100 parts of dogwood fruit.
A preparation method of a traditional Chinese medicine formula for dispelling wind cold, ventilating the lung and relieving cough comprises the following steps:
s1, crushing: weighing radix rehmanniae Preparata, glycyrrhrizae radix, rhizoma Dioscoreae, semen Ginkgo, alismatis rhizoma, herba Ephedrae, cortex moutan, radix Aconiti lateralis Preparata, poria and Corni fructus in sequence according to Chinese medicinal raw materials, placing the above Chinese medicinal raw materials in a Chinese medicinal grinder in sequence, sieving with 60-120 mesh sieve, and respectively preparing radix rehmanniae Preparata powder, glycyrrhrizae radix powder, rhizoma Dioscoreae powder, semen Ginkgo powder, alismatis rhizoma powder, herba Ephedrae powder, cortex moutan powder, radix Aconiti lateralis Preparata powder, poria powder and Corni fructus powder;
s2, refining honey: placing Mel in a pan, heating at 100-120 deg.C until the Mel is slightly boiled, keeping slightly boiling, removing foam and surface wax, sieving to remove dead bee and impurities with a sieve, pouring into the pan, refining until there is much viscosity by twisting with fingers, but no long white thread appears in both hands, and keeping the Mel in the pan at 40-60 deg.C for use;
s3, mixing: placing radix rehmanniae Preparata powder, glycyrrhrizae radix powder, rhizoma Dioscoreae powder, semen Ginkgo powder, alismatis rhizoma powder, herba Ephedrae powder, cortex moutan powder, radix Aconiti lateralis Preparata powder, poria powder and Corni fructus powder in step S1 into a stirrer, stirring and heating to 40-60 deg.C until uniformly mixed to obtain mixed Chinese medicinal powder;
s3, pelleting: and (3) cooling the refined honey prepared in the step (S2) to a normal temperature state, taking a proper amount of mixed traditional Chinese medicine powder, kneading the refined honey wrapped mixed traditional Chinese medicine powder into a 3-5mm pill shape, and storing the pill in a refrigerating chamber.
Preferably, the ratio of the refined honey and the mixed traditional Chinese medicine powder in the step S3 is 1:1-3:1.
compared with the prior art, the invention has the following beneficial effects:
prepared rehmannia root, radix rehmanniae Praeparata is warm in nature and enters liver and kidney meridians; has effects in replenishing blood, nourishing yin, replenishing essence, and nourishing marrow;
the liquorice has the effects of clearing away heat and toxic materials, eliminating phlegm and relieving cough, tonifying lung qi and strengthening spleen and stomach;
the rhizoma Dioscoreae has effects of invigorating spleen and replenishing qi, quenching thirst, promoting fluid production, building body and caring skin;
gingko has little toxicity, mild nature, astringent, sweet and bitter taste and enters lung meridian; has effects in astringing lung, eliminating phlegm, relieving asthma, stopping leukorrhagia, and reducing urination;
alismatis rhizoma has effects of promoting diuresis, eliminating dampness, clearing heat, and inhibiting bacteria;
herba Ephedrae has effects of inducing sweat, relieving exterior syndrome, dispersing lung qi, relieving asthma, inducing diuresis, and relieving swelling;
cortex moutan has effects of clearing heat, cooling blood, relieving inflammation, relieving pain, promoting blood circulation, and removing blood stasis;
the aconite has obvious functions of dispelling cold and relieving pain;
poria has effects of promoting diuresis, eliminating dampness, invigorating spleen and improving heart;
the dogwood fruit has the effects of protecting the liver, tonifying qi, promoting the production of body fluid, diminishing inflammation and sterilizing.
The invention adopts prepared rhizome of rehmannia, liquorice, chinese yam, ginkgo, rhizoma alismatis, ephedra, cortex moutan, radix aconiti lateralis preparata, tuckahoe and pulp of dogwood fruit to treat cough of patients by dispelling wind cold and ventilating lung qi, and has quick effect and relieved pain of the patients.

Detailed description of the preferred embodiment
Taking out 5 Chinese medicinal pills prepared in the first, second and third embodiment cases, taking the pills with warm water respectively in the morning and at night once a day, clinically applying the pills to 60 patients, taking 15 patients as a group, respectively setting a first embodiment case A group, a second embodiment case B group and a third embodiment case C group, and taking a control group of conventional medicines, and observing the cure condition within 15 days;
3T | 6T | 9T | 12T | 15T | |
group A | 0 | 5 | 6 | 4 | 0 |
Group B | 2 | 9 | 4 | 0 | 0 |
Group C | 3 | 5 | 7 | 0 | 0 |
Control group | 0 | 1 | 3 | 3 | 5 |
According to clinical observation, after the pills of the group A, the group B and the group C prepared from the traditional Chinese medicine composition are taken, the cure rate can reach 100 percent after the pills are treated for 12 days, and the pills can be completely cured in 12 days;
after 9 days of treatment, the cure rate of the pills of the group B and the group C prepared from the traditional Chinese medicine composition can reach 100 percent, and the pills can be completely cured in 9 days.
